UnRAVEL
SCORE
2023
March
To address the lack of basic research competency of critical appraisal in undergraduate medical students in india , Project UNRAVEL , A proud triphasic project -was launched The first phase was conducting a workshop that targeted the CB lacunae amongst medical students, impacting a total of 54 participants, The second phase was launching a DAF activity, Third phase is a national level research , the proposal for which has been sent to relevant EB official.
Speak NOW
SCORE, SCORA
2023
March
In today's world, many adolescents face challenges when it comes to fostering their sexual and reproductive health due to a lack of accurate information. Recognizing the significance of research in addressing this issue, a competition was organised to cultivate the spirit of research in sexual and reproductive health and rights (SRHR) among medical students in India. By encouraging debate and dialogue, this initiative aimed to invigorate SRHR by suggesting alternative answers to medical and social questions.
